OK, this builds fine (on rawhide); rpmlint has only one complaint:
herbstluftwm.x86_64: W: non-conffile-in-etc
/etc/bash_completion.d/herbstclient-completion
This is fine; those files shouldn't be there, but that's not your fault.
The project makefile is annoying; it hides the actual compiler call (so we
can't verify the compiler flags it is using), does not provide a verbose mode
and inserts control sequences which look more like line noise in the build
logs. I had to build with a quick patch to get that done properly:
diff -up ./rules.mk.orig ./rules.mk
--- ./rules.mk.orig 2012-04-20 16:05:30.840050949 -0500
+++ ./rules.mk 2012-04-20 16:05:44.030637343 -0500
@@ -4,18 +4,14 @@ all: $(TARGET)
rb: clean all
$(TARGET): $(OBJ)
- $(call colorecho,LD,$(TARGET))
- @$(LD) -o $@ $(LDFLAGS) $(OBJ) $(LIBS)
+ $(LD) -o $@ $(LDFLAGS) $(OBJ) $(LIBS)
$(SRCDIR)/%.o: $(SRCDIR)/%.c $(HEADER)
- $(call colorecho,CC,$<)
- @$(CC) -c $(CFLAGS) -o $@ $<
+ $(CC) -c $(CFLAGS) -o $@ $<
clean:
- $(call colorecho,RM,$(TARGET))
- @rm -f $(TARGET)
- $(call colorecho,RM,$(OBJ))
- @rm -f $(OBJ)
+ rm -f $(TARGET)
+ rm -f $(OBJ)
info:
@echo Some Info:
and the result is that indeed, the package isn't built with the proper Fedora
compiler flags. Unfortunately the makefile doesn't allow you to pass your own,
so I used the following in %prep:
sed -i -e 's/^CFLAGS =.*/CFLAGS = %{optflags} -std=c99 -pedantic ${INCS} -D
_XOPEN_SOURCE=600/' config.mk
Still seems to build after that but you'll need to do some testing.
